Should I wear a belt with a 3 piece suit?
Do you wear a belt with a 3 piece suit? You should not wear a belt with a three-piece suit because it will cause the waistcoat to bunch up. With this design, the fit is always essential, and anything that compromises it will not look good.
How to wear a 3 piece suit? Jacket can be worn buttoned or unbuttoned. The waistcoat must always be worn buttoned all the way up, leaving the bottom button open. In the past the open bottom button prevented the waistcoat from riding-up when on horseback.
Do you close a three-piece suit?
How to wear a waistcoat with your three piece suit? Waistcoats should be worn very close to your body, covering your belt area and leaving no gap between it and your trousers. Always keep your waistcoat buttoned up.

What type of shirt goes with a bow tie?
The bow tie is in close contact with the collar of the shirt, so make sure you choose a shirt with a collar with a gap between the ends of the collar proportional to the wings of the bow tie. Go with classic collars with a medium to narrow gap, such as French, English, club or broken.

What color should my bow tie be?
Remember that your shirt should be lighter than your bow tie for the best contrast. The only exception is when you’re wearing a solid dark-colored shirt, like navy blue or black. You can choose a bow tie in the same color (darker shade) than your shirt, as long as the bow tie still stands out.
